Who is Giannis Antetokounmpo? The "Greek Freak" is a professional basketball player for the Milwaukee Bucks of the National Basketball Association (NBA).

Born in Greece to Nigerian parents, Antetokounmpo began playing basketball at a young age. He quickly rose through the ranks of the Greek basketball system, and in 2013, he was selected 15th overall by the Bucks in the NBA draft.

Antetokounmpo has quickly become one of the most dominant players in the NBA. He is a versatile forward who can score, rebound, and defend at a high level. He has been named an NBA All-Star four times and was named the NBA Most Valuable Player in 2019 and 2020.

In addition to his NBA success, Antetokounmpo has also led the Greek national team to a silver medal at the 2020 Summer Olympics.

Born

The birth of Giannis Antetokounmpo in Athens, Greece, on December 6, 1994, marked the beginning of an extraordinary basketball journey. Born to Nigerian parents who had immigrated to Greece, Antetokounmpo faced numerous challenges growing up but found solace and passion in basketball.

  • Early Life and Basketball Roots: Growing up in Athens, Antetokounmpo and his family faced financial hardships and discrimination. Basketball became an outlet for him, providing a sense of community and purpose. He honed his skills on the streets and local courts, developing his unique combination of size, athleticism, and ball-handling abilities.
  • Rise to Prominence: Antetokounmpo's talent was undeniable, and he quickly rose through the ranks of Greek basketball. In 2013, at just 19 years old, he was drafted 15th overall by the Milwaukee Bucks, becoming the first Greek player to be drafted into the NBA.
  • Global Impact and Inspiration: Antetokounmpo's story has resonated with people worldwide, particularly those from immigrant backgrounds. His journey from humble beginnings to becoming an NBA superstar serves as an inspiration, demonstrating the power of perseverance and hard work in overcoming adversity.
  • Cultural Significance: Antetokounmpo's success has also had a significant impact on Greece and the global perception of the country. He has become a symbol of pride for Greece, showcasing the country's growing basketball talent and its contributions to the sport at the highest level.
